Have you read "The Book of the Springfield by E. C. Crossman".
It's a very informative book with a lot of information about the Springfield 1903 including photos.
The copy I have is a 1951 reprint and with an updated second section included by Roy Dunlap and publisher Thomas G. Samworth Books.
The original 1931 printings are hard to find and expensive.
